Abstract
Geographical Information Systems (GIS) are special types of information systems managing geo-spatial data. The GIS is used to manage geo-referenced information and it represents spatial position of any location into digital map. The GIS also facilitates the user to retrieve spatial information easily using a lot of geographic functions such as data integration, mapping, and overlaying, buffering, projection etc. In the traditional GIS, layer wise data extraction is difficult as it is not followed layerwise data storing. In this regard, our system is able to extract spatial data layer wise from database according to the user's interest. It is also able to work with both spatial data and attribute data (non-spatial data). Spatial data describes the locations and shapes of geographic features like roads, buildings and streets while attribute data describes the characteristics of geographic features (like name, type etc.). In this paper, we present an approach to implement a map of a town considering the layers (road, building like administrative office, health center, educational organization etc.) using spatial database and map-viewer.
